百年教育职业培训中心 百年教育学习服务平台
题库试卷

东大计算机组成与系统结构期末考试复习资料与参考答案

来源: 更新时间:

3亿多的题库,支持文图片,语音搜题,包含国家开放大广东开放大云南开放大北京开放大上海开放大江苏开放大超青奥鹏等等多个平台题库,考试作业必备神器。正确答案:微信搜索【渝粤搜题】公众号广东开放大学2023

3亿多的题库,支持文图片,语音搜题,包含国家开放大广东开放大云南开放大北京开放大上海开放大江苏开放大超青奥鹏等等多个平台题库,考试作业必备神器。

正确 答案:微信搜索【渝粤搜题】公众号

广东开放大学 2023年春季招生简章

计算机组成与系统结构复习题

一选择题

某计算机字长16位,它的存贮容量是64KB,若按字编址,那么它的寻址范围是( )

A. 64K B. 32K C. 64KB D. 32 KB

计算机操作的最小时间单位是( )

A.时钟周期 B.指令周期 CCPU周期 D.微周期

微程序控制器中,机器指令与微指令的关系是( )

A. 每一条机器指令由一条微指令来执行

B. 每一条机器指令由一段微指令编写的微程序来解释执行

C. 每一条机器指令组成的程序可由一条微指令来执行

D. 一条微指令由若干条机器指令组成

发生中断请求的条件之一是( )

A. 一条指令执行结束 B. 一次 I/O 操作结束

C. 机器内部发生故障 D. 一次DMA 操作结束

假定下列字符码中有奇偶校验位,但没有数据错误,采用偶校校验的字符码是( )

A 11001011 B 11010110 C 11000001 ( ) 11001001

为确定下一条微指令的地址,通常采用断定方式,其基本思想是( )

A.用程序计数器PC来产生后继微指令地址

B.用微程序计数器μPC来产生后继微指令地址

C.通过微指令顺序控制字段由设计者指定或由设计者指定的判别字段控制产生后继微指令地址

D.通过指令中指定一个专门字段来控制产生后继微指令地址

微指令操作码长9位,采用字段直接编码方式,分3段每段3位。则共能表示 种微命令,最多可并行( )个。

A213 B99 C242 D183

周期挪用方式常用于( )方式的输入/输出中

A DMA B 中断 C 程序传送 ( )通道

中断向量地址是( )

A 子程序入口地址 B 中断服务例行程序入口地址

C中断服务例行程序入口地址的指示器 ( )中断返回地址

冯·诺依曼机工作的基本方式的特点是( )

A 多指令流单数据流

B 按地址访问并顺序执行指令

C 堆栈操作

( ) 存贮器按内容选择地址

计算机系统中的存贮器系统是指( )

A RAM存贮器 B ROM存贮器

C 主存贮器 ( ) cach主存贮器和外存贮器

相联存贮器是按( )进行寻址的存贮器。

A 地址方式 B 堆栈方式

C 内容指定方式 ( ) 地址方式与堆栈方式

若浮点数用补码表示,则判断运算结果是否为规格化数的方法是( )

A 阶符与数符相同为规格化数

B 阶符与数符相异为规格化数

C 数符与尾数小数点后第一位数字相异为规格化数

D数符与尾数小数点后第一位数字相同为规格化数

在定点二进制运算器中,减法运算一般通过( )来实现。

A 原码运算的二进制减法器

B 补码运算的二进制减法器

C 原码运算的十进制加法器

( ) 补码运算的二进制加法器

CPU中跟踪指令后继地址的寄存器是______

A 主存地址寄存器 B 程序计数器 C 指令寄存器 ( )状态条件寄存器

采用DMA方式传送数据时,每传送一个数据就要用一个( )时间。

A.指令周期 B.机器周期 C.存储周期 D.总线周期

在单级中断系统中,CPU一旦响应中断,则立即关闭( )标志,以防本次中断服务结束前同级的其他中断源产生另一次中断进行干扰。

A 中断允许 B 中断请求 C 中断屏蔽 ( )中断保护

主存贮器和CPU之间增加cache的目的是( )

A 解决CPU和主存之间的速度匹配问题

B 扩大主存贮器容量

C 扩大CPU中通用寄存器的数量

( ) 既扩大主存贮器容量,又扩大CPU中通用寄存器的数量

为了便于实现多级中断,保存现场信息最有效的办法是采用( )

A 通用寄存器 B 堆栈 C 存储器 ( ) 外存

定点16位字长的字,采用2的补码形式表示时,一个字所能表示的整数范围是( )

A -215 ~ +( ) B -( )~ +( )

C -( )~ +215 ( )-215 ~ +215

SRAM芯片,存储容量为64K16位,该芯片的地址线和数据线数目为( )

A 6416 B 1664 C 648 ( )1616

运算器虽有许多部件组成,但核心部件是( )

A.数据总线 B.算术逻辑运算单元 C.多路开关 D.累加寄存器

单地址指令中为了完成两个数的算术运算,除地址码指明的一个操作数以外,另一个数常需采用( )

A.堆栈寻址方式 B.立即寻址方式 C.隐含寻址方式 D.间接寻址方式

完整的计算机系统应包括( )

A 运算存储控制器

B 外部设备和主机

C 主机和实用程序

( ) 配套的硬件设备和软件系统

某一RAM芯片,其容量为5128位,包括电源和接地端,该芯片引出线的最小数目应是( )

A 23 B 25 C 50 ( ) 19

至今为止,计算机中的所有信息仍以二进制方式表示的理由是( )

A.节约元件 B 运算速度快

C 物理器件的性能决定 ( )信息处理方便

CPU响应中断时,进入“中断周期”,采用硬件方法保护并更新程序计数器PC内容,而不是由软件完成,主要是为了( )

A 能进入中断处理程序,并能正确返回源程序

B 节省主存空间

C 提高处理机速度

( ) 易于编制中断处理程序

采用虚拟存贮器的主要目的是( )

A 提高主存贮器的存取速度

B 扩大主存贮器的存贮空间,并能进行自动管理和调度

C 提高外存贮器的存取速度

( ) 扩大外存贮器的存贮空间

EEPROM是指( )

A. 只读存储器; B. 可两次擦除并编程的只读存储器;

C. 电擦除可编程的只读存储器。 D. 随机读写存储器

水平型微指令与垂直型微指令相比,( )

A. 前者一次只能完成一个操作

B. 后者一次只能完成一个操作

C. 两者都是一次只能完成一个操作

D. 两者都能一次完成多个操作

变址寻址方式中,操作数的有效地址等于( )

A. 堆栈指示器内容加上形式地址( )

B. 程序计数器内容加上形式地址

C. 基值寄存器内容加上形式地址

D. 变址寄存器内容加上形式地址

属于发生中断请求的条件的是( )

A. 一次逻辑运算结束 B. 一次DMA操作结束

C. 一次算术运算结束 D. 一条指令执行结束

由于CPU内部的操作速度较快,而CPU访问一次主存所花的时间较长,因此机器周期通常用( )来规定。

A.主存中读取一个数据字的最长时间

B.主存中读取一个指令字的最短时间

C.主存中读取一个数据字的平均时间

D.主存中写入一个数据字的平均时间

在定点小数机中,( )可以表示-1

A 原码 B 补码 C 移码 ( ) 反码

已知X为整数,且[X] = 10011011,则X的十进制数值是( )

A. +155 B. –101 C. –155 D. +101

指令系统采用不同寻址方式的目的是( )

A. 实现存贮程序和程序控制;

B. 缩短指令长度,扩大寻址空间,提高编程灵活性;。

C. 可直接访问外存;

D. 提供扩展操作码的可能并降低指令译码的难度;

指令的寻址方式有顺序和跳跃两种方式,采用跳跃寻址方式,可以实现( )

A 堆栈寻址 B 程序的条件转移

C 程序的无条件转移 ( ) 程序的条件转移或无条件转移

双端口存储器所以能高速进行读 / 写,是因为采用( )

A 高速芯片 B 两套相互独立的读写电路 C 流水技术 ( )新型器件

存储器位扩展是指增大了( )

A.字数 B.字长 C.速度 D.以上都不是

下列不属于微指令设计所追求的目标的是:( )

A.提高微程序的执行速度 B.缩短微指令的长度

C.提高微程序设计的灵活性 D.增大控制存储器的容量

二判断题

计算机唯一能直接执行的语言是机器语言。( )

第一台电子数字计算机ENIAC采用的就是二进制表示数据。( )

一位十进制数用B码表示需要4位二进制码。( )

定点机算术运算会产生溢出是因为内存容量不够大。( )

浮点加减运算中,尾数溢出则表示浮点运算溢出。( )

EPROM是可改写的,因而也是随机存储器的一种。( )

半导体RAM信息可读可写,且断电后仍能保持记忆。( )

垂直型微指令采用较长的微程序结构去换取较短的微指令结构。( )

多体交叉存储器主要解决扩充容量问题。( )

Cache的功能由软硬件共同实现。( )

存储器主要用来存放程序。( )

运算器的功能是进行算术运算。( )

控制存储器用来存放实现全部指令系统的所有微程序。( )

DRAM必须刷新。( )

多体交叉存储器主要解决扩充容量问题。( )

信息序列11001101的偶校验位是1( )

SRAMDRAM都是易失性的半导体存储器。( )

访问存储器的请求是由CPU发出的。( )

冯·诺依曼机工作方式的基本特点是按地址访问并顺序执行指令。( )

Cache对于各级程序员都是透明的。 ( )

CPU访问存储器的时间是由存储器的容量决定的。( )

三填空题

双端口存储器和多模块交叉存储器属于( )存储器结构。前者采用( )技术,后者采用( )技术。

DMA控制器访存采用以下三种方法:( ( ( )

对存储器的要求是( )( )( ),为了解决这三个方面的矛盾。计算机采用多级存储器体系结构。

CPU中,保存当前正在执行的指令的寄存器为( ),保存当前正在执行的指令的地址的寄存器为( ),保存CPU访存地址的寄存器为( )

在浮点加法算中,当尾数需要右移时,应进行舍入处理。常用的舍入方法有( )( )这两种。

综合题

某微机的指令格式如下所示:

15 10 9 8 7 0

操作码

X

D


其中,D表示位移量,X为寻址特征位,且有:

X=00——直接寻址;

X=01——用变址寄存器X1进行变址寻址;

X=10——用变址寄存器X2进行变址寻址;

X=11——相对寻址。

( )=1234H( )=0037H( )=110AH( ),请确定下列指令中操作数的有效地址。

(1)4420H (2)2244H (3)13DH (4)3525H

某计算机有5级中断,硬件中断响应从高到低优先顺序是:I1I2I3I4I5。回答下列问题:

( )在下表中设计各级中断处理程序的中断屏蔽码( ),使中断处理优先顺序为I5I1I4I3I2

( )若在运行主程序的1时刻( ),同时出现II3级中断请求,而在CPU处理其中I3级中断过程中某时刻( )又同时出现II5级中断请求。请按( )设定的中断处理次序在下图中画出CPU运行上述程序的轨迹,并在轴上标注2时刻。

设浮点数字长为16位,其中阶码是5位移码,尾数是11位补码( ),基值为2。请将十进制数( )按上述格式表示成二进制规格化浮点数,并写出该格式的规格化浮点数表示数的范围。

CPU共有16根地址线,8根数据线,并用MREQ作访存控制信号,用R/W作读写控制信号,现有2K4位的RAM芯片和2K8位的ROM芯片若干片,以及74138译码器和各种门电路(自定),要求组成一个存储系统,其最大4K地址空间为系统程序区,与其相邻2K地址空间为用户程序区。

(1)合理选用上述存储芯片,说明各选几片?写出每片存储芯片的地址范围。

(2)画出CPU与存储器的连接图,详细画出存储芯片的片选逻辑。

4题图 74138译码器

答案

选择题

1

2

3

4

5

6

7

8

9

10

11

12

13

14

B

A

B

C

D

C

A

A

C

B

D

C

C

D

15

16

17

18

19

20

21

22

23

24

25

26

27

28

B

C

C

A

B

A

D

B

C

D

D

C

A

B

29

30

31

32

33

34

35

36

37

38

39

40

C

B

D

B

B

B

B

B

D

B

B

D

判断题

1

2

3

4

5

6

7

8

9

10

11

12

13

14















15

16

17

18

19

20

21
















填空题

并行 空间并行 时间并行

停止CPU访问 周期挪用 DMACPU交替访问

容量大 速度快 成本低

指令寄存器IR 程序计数器PC 内存地址寄存器AR

01入法 末位恒置1

综合题

答:

(1) X=00D=20H,有效地址EA=20H

(2) X=10D=44H,有效地址EA=110AH+44H=114EH

(3) X=11D=DH,有效地址EA=1234H+DH=1313H

(4) X=01D=25H,有效地址EA=0037H+25H=005CH

答:

( )屏蔽码设计如下表所示。

( )作图如下。其中进入某级中断即刻被打断,用较短线段表示即可。

答:

11/128 = 1011B2-7 =0.1011000000B2-3

真值-35位移码表示为24+( )=13=1101B

尾数0.1011000表示成11位补码为0.1011000000 11/128按题意要求的二进制规格化浮点表示为:11010.1011000000 ( )

规格化的尾数负值范围-1~-0.5,规格化的尾数正值范围0.5 ~( )

阶的范围是-16~+15

故有该格式规格化浮点数表示数范围如下--

负值: -215 ~ -2-12-16 ( )

正值: 2-12-16 ~ ( )215

其中2-1可以写为( );另外写法上可以比较自由,四个最值对应相同即可。

答:

根据题目要求,系统程序区选用两片2K8位的ROM芯片构成,用户程序区选用两片2K4RAM芯片构成。地址空间描述如下:

ROM芯片1对应的空间为:

1111 1111 1111 1111

1111 1000 0000 0000

ROM芯片2对应的空间为:

1111 0111 1111 1111

1111 0000 0000 0000

RAM芯片2( )对应的空间为:

1110 1111 1111 1111

1110 1000 0000 0000

连接图如下:


电话咨询